Subject: Heads up — key rotation for Lintledger

Hi on-call, quick one: we rotated the credential that the CI uploader uses to push the static-analysis baseline file to Lintledger. If tonight's pipeline complains about a rejected baseline upload, that's why — just restart the job after updating the secret. Old key dies at midnight. The new key for the baseline service is below.

service key, fawip-bajef: kto11_Qt5wZK9vdNC

The renewal of our three-year agreement with Torvane Materials has been assessed in detail. Proposed terms include a 4.2% unit-price increase, partially offset by improved volume rebates and extended payment terms of sixty days. Sensitivity analysis indicates a net annual cost impact of under 1% on the Meridia product line, assuming stable demand. Legal has flagged no material changes to liability clauses. We recommend approval, subject to the conditions outlined in the confidential note below.

confidential, yawip-bahif: Zorokox Partners plans to lower the Casax list price by 28.0 percent in April. The board signed off on a budget of $271.0 million for Project Juldor. The renewal with Pelokox Partners closes at $410.1 million a year, 3.4 percent below the last contract. Project Pelok slips by a full year because of the audit delay.

Subject: On-call heads-up — Orchardly catalog cache. Welcome aboard. The main gotcha: catalog price updates invalidate by SKU, but bundle pages cache composite keys, so a stale bundle can outlive its parts. If support reports wrong bundle prices, purge the composite namespace first. We'll cover this at the weekly sync; the invalidation playbook is on this internal page.

wiki page, yagef-tawif: https://sentry.lumicdata.local/view/merge_requests/pipeline/merge_requests/e08f7f35c80b5755